28947609637736821135610397
Odd
28947609637736821135610397 is odd
Previous odd number is 28947609637736821135610395
Next odd number is 28947609637736821135610399
Cubed
24257057765466601700221470460580961681239481303150584419179687403958232040773
Squared
Binary
1011111110001111001010001000000011000100100001001011111100110101111011001001000011101